IDFC First Bank reported Q1 FY26 (quarter ended June 30, 2025) net profit of Rs. 463 crore, down 32% year-on-year but up 52% sequentially. The YoY profit decline was mainly driven by higher provisions of Rs. 1,659 crore, largely due to slippages in the microfinance segment, with credit cost rising to ~2.0% from ~1.8% in FY25. Customer deposits grew strongly by 25.5% YoY to Rs. 2,56,799 crore, while loans and advances rose 21% YoY to Rs. 2,53,233 crore, led by mortgage, vehicle, business banking, MSME and wholesale loans. Asset quality showed a slight deterioration with gross NPA at 1.97% (vs 1.87% in March 2025) and net NPA at 0.55%, though PCR remained healthy at 72.3%. NIM compressed 24 bps QoQ to 5.71% due to repo rate pass-through and asset mix changes, and the bank announced a Rs. 7,500 crore capital raise which would lift CRAR to 17.60% from the current 15.01%.
Mixed quarter for shareholders: strong deposit and loan growth signals a healthy franchise, but the sharp YoY profit decline and rising NPAs in microfinance may weigh on sentiment in the near term. The Rs. 7,500 crore capital raise is a significant positive that strengthens the balance sheet and supports future growth, while management expects margins and MFI issues to improve by H2 FY26.
